A recommender system based on collaborative filtering using ontology and dimensionality reduction techniques

被引:223
作者
Nilashi, Mehrbakhsh [1 ,2 ]
Ibrahim, Othman [1 ]
Bagherifard, Karamollah [3 ]
机构
[1] Univ Teknol Malaysia, Fac Comp, Skudai 81310, Johor, Malaysia
[2] Islamic Azad Univ, Lahijan Branch, Dept Comp Engn, Lahijan, Iran
[3] Islamic Azad Univ, Yasooj Branch, Young Researchers & Elite Club, Yasuj, Iran
关键词
Recommender systems; Ontology; Clustering; Dimensionality reduction; Scalability; Sparsity; OF-THE-ART; FUZZY-LOGIC; MODEL; ALGORITHM; TRUST; ACCURACY; IMPROVE; QUALITY;
D O I
10.1016/j.eswa.2017.09.058
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Improving the efficiency of methods has been a big challenge in recommender systems. It has been also important to consider the trade-off between the accuracy and the computation time in recommending the items by the recommender systems as they need to produce the recommendations accurately and meanwhile in real-time. In this regard, this research develops a new hybrid recommendation method based on Collaborative Filtering (CF) approaches. Accordingly, in this research we solve two main drawbacks of recommender systems, sparsity and scalability, using dimensionality reduction and ontology techniques. Then, we use ontology to improve the accuracy of recommendations in CF part. In the CF part, we also use a dimensionality reduction technique, Singular Value Decomposition (SVD), to find the most similar items and users in each cluster of items and users which can significantly improve the scalability of the recommendation method. We evaluate the method on two real-world datasets to show its effectiveness and compare the results with the results of methods in the literature. The results showed that our method is effective in improving the sparsity and scalability problems in CF. (C) 2017 Elsevier Ltd. All rights reserved.
引用
收藏
页码:507 / 520
页数:14
相关论文
共 74 条
[1]   Toward the next generation of recommender systems: A survey of the state-of-the-art and possible extensions [J].
Adomavicius, G ;
Tuzhilin, A .
IEEE TRANSACTIONS ON KNOWLEDGE AND DATA ENGINEERING, 2005, 17 (06) :734-749
[2]   A semantic enhanced hybrid recommendation approach: A case study of e-Government tourism service recommendation system [J].
Al-Hassan, Malak ;
Lu, Haiyan ;
Lu, Jie .
DECISION SUPPORT SYSTEMS, 2015, 72 :97-109
[3]  
[Anonymous], 1979, Cognitive Science
[4]  
[Anonymous], 2001, WWW, DOI 10.1145/371920.372071
[5]  
[Anonymous], 1998, P 14 C UNC ART INT
[6]  
[Anonymous], 2001, PRINCIPLES FORECASTI
[7]  
[Anonymous], 2002, P 5 INT C COMP INF S
[8]  
[Anonymous], 1989, Automatic Text Processing: The Transformation, Analysis, Retrieval of Information by Computer
[9]  
Antoniou G., 2004, A semantic web primer
[10]   A semantic recommendation algorithm for the PaaSport platform-as-a-service marketplace [J].
Bassiliades, Nick ;
Symeonidis, Moisis ;
Meditskos, Georgios ;
Kontopoulos, Efstratios ;
Gouvas, Panagiotis ;
Vlahavas, Ioannis .
EXPERT SYSTEMS WITH APPLICATIONS, 2017, 67 :203-227